    There are Australian laws and regulations that regulate plumbing work in Australia. This means that there are few home plumbing tasks that you can DIY. Besides, a lot can go wrong with DIY plumbing projects. However, there are also plumbing works that you can successfully DIY. Read on to know when to DIY and when to call a professional plumber.

  • Plumbing Issues You Can Fix Yourself


    You can attempt DIY plumbing for plumbing issues such as replacing tap washers, installing shower heads or performing minor tap leak repairs. However, it would help if you invited licensed plumbers to fix complex leaking showers, effectively deal with blocked drains, or repair hot water systems. This is the best way to ensure these plumbing issues are correctly fixed, and the project is insured.

    New faucet installations


    It is possible to install a new faucet yourself. You would have to turn off the hot and cold water valves. Then, you can remove and fix the old faucet and replace it with the new one.


    Leaky faucet repairs


    While leaky faucet repairs are more technical than installations, you can also take some steps to fix them. Turning off water valves is the first step in draining water from plumbing systems. Next, you can use a washcloth to cover the drain and remove the decorative handles.



    This will allow enough room to unscrew the nuts that attach the faucet handle to the stem. Your final step is to take out and replace the old washers and O-rings with the new duplicates.


    Fixing running toilets


    An occasional DIY solution for running toilets is to restore the flapper in the tank to its proper place.


    Burst pipes


    You may have issues with your exterior plumbing fixtures. It may simply be that your inbound or outbound pipes have worn out, or you may have burst pipes due to flooding or large tree roots.



    You may also have frozen pipes. These are all instances when you need to call a professional plumber. They will perform pipe inspections to locate the problem and implement solutions such as pipe relining.


    Interior plumbing repairs


    It's usually time to call a competent plumber if you want to do plumbing repair work on floors, ceilings, or the walls of your building. They can also help you fix faulty showers and sinks.



    Plumbing renovation


    Major renovation projects or plumbing jobs such as bathroom remodelling and bathroom renovations require the services of a professional plumber. Likewise, you need a professional plumber to fix your kitchen sink or plumbing. They can help you get the required plumbing permits. At the same time, they know what building codes apply to such renovation projects.
